On what basis should PPE be selected in LPWS?

Explanation:
PPE should be chosen based on hazard assessment and task-specific risk. For each task, identify what could cause injury or exposure, how severe it could be, and how workers might come into contact with the hazard. Use that information to select equipment that provides the right level of protection for those exact hazards, matching the protection rating to the situation—eye protection for splashes, gloves suited to the chemical or mechanical risk, a respirator with the correct cartridge, hearing protection for loud work, and so on. Make sure the PPE fits well, is comfortable, and is compatible with other gear and the task workflow, so workers actually use it properly. The emphasis is on aligning protection with the actual risk, rather than on availability, cost, personal preference, or brand familiarity; those factors may influence procurement, but they do not determine adequate protection.
